BIOGRAPHY:
PATTI SPADARO is a creative, passionate lead guitarist/singer/songwriter who has recorded and released several CDs and performed all over the country. Patti spent 10 years working as a full time musician in the Los Angeles area - performing, touring, recording, and teaching guitar lessons. Now she is back in her home state of PA, playing around Pittsburgh. She performs with the Patti Spadaro Band, and with other bands, as well as solo acoustic.
The Patti Spadaro Band plays bluesy jam-rock originals and covers with wailing female lead guitar and vocals. Their music has a good groove and a good vibe, with lots of tasty improvisation.
